PCB

PCB, also known as Printed Circuit Board, is the most commonly used board in electronic circuits. It is composed of an insulating substrate and a wire network connected to it, which can achieve circuit connection and control.

The development process of PCBs can be traced back to the 1930s, when American electronic engineer Paul Eisler developed the first printed circuit board. He used the bottom layer of cardboard, covered with a copper foil sheet, and printed the corresponding circuit pattern. Then, he used corrosion and other methods to form unnecessary copper foil into circuit connecting wires. Nowadays, with the popularization of electronic products, the application of PCBs is becoming increasingly widespread. From simple remote controls to complex computer devices, almost all electronic devices require the use of PCBs.

The composition structure of a PCB is relatively simple, generally consisting of a core material, copper foil, small holes, circuits, and other on-board components. The connection between these components and circuits is achieved through conductive materials such as copper foil, while the connection between components is achieved through holes and solder joints on the board.

PCB plays a very important role in the electronics industry. It is an important component of various electronic devices. Generally speaking, if the circuit is complex and fixed electronic components are used to form the circuit, the manufacturing cost is often high, while the cost of printed circuit boards is lower, demonstrating better applicability and playing a very important role in the development of modern electronic technology.
